Description
The writer, having observed the solution of citrate of bismuth, obtained by the addition of ammonia, to have an acid reaction, and also that an excess of that alkali occasioned a precipitate of oxide of bismuth, inferred the existence of a compound salt of bismuth and ammonia; this was subsequently confirmed.
